diff options
-rw-r--r-- | src/vpp/api/custom_dump.c | 8 | ||||
-rw-r--r-- | test/framework.py | 2 |
2 files changed, 8 insertions, 2 deletions
diff --git a/src/vpp/api/custom_dump.c b/src/vpp/api/custom_dump.c index 49fe2a8bd26..a51b6aa2dc6 100644 --- a/src/vpp/api/custom_dump.c +++ b/src/vpp/api/custom_dump.c @@ -1806,9 +1806,15 @@ static void *vl_api_cli_inband_t_print (vl_api_cli_inband_t * mp, void *handle) { u8 *s; + u8 *cmd = 0; + u32 length = ntohl (mp->length); - s = format (0, "SCRIPT: cli_inband "); + vec_validate (cmd, length); + clib_memcpy (cmd, mp->cmd, length); + s = format (0, "SCRIPT: exec %v ", cmd); + + vec_free (cmd); FINISH; } diff --git a/test/framework.py b/test/framework.py index e2b4d7bd566..bf21c57d199 100644 --- a/test/framework.py +++ b/test/framework.py @@ -474,7 +474,7 @@ class VppTestCase(unittest.TestCase): self.logger.info("Moving %s to %s\n" % (tmp_api_trace, vpp_api_trace_log)) os.rename(tmp_api_trace, vpp_api_trace_log) - self.logger.info(self.vapi.ppcli("api trace dump %s" % + self.logger.info(self.vapi.ppcli("api trace custom-dump %s" % vpp_api_trace_log)) else: self.registry.unregister_all(self.logger) |